Three easy steps to help you take control of healthcare costs.

It is a brand new year, and for many of us, that means starting payments against a brand new insurance year. Health care prices might cause sticker-shock for some who have higher deductibles.

However, the beginning of the year is actually the perfect time to tackle your deductible. The sooner you meet it, the more services you can have throughout the year at a lower cost. It is a proactive approach to meeting your yearly health care needs.

At Teton Therapy, we understand that many people may need some help navigating how to approach high healthcare costs. Here are three tips to help relieve some of the financial barriers you might have to seeking medical care:

1. Discuss costs right away.

We understand talking about money can be uncomfortable for a lot of people. However, we know that the cost of healthcare is a big deal to almost everyone. Once these barriers are discussed, our patients can focus 100% on their treatment. This can get you better faster. We don’t want our patients to fall off of their treatment plan or to avoid seeking physical or occupational therapy in the future because they are afraid of the cost.

2. Know the details of your insurance plan.

Do you have a deductible, copay, coinsurance? How much is your deductible and coinsurance? What exactly are you responsible for?
